Nothing political here, I have just got hold of ‘Taking the long way’ a bit late I know. I am a great fan of the Chicks previous recordings - great performance, musicianship and production.

This CD is one of the worst productions I have ever heard. A wall of over compressed mush. What’s going on?

Mark Butcher wrote:
A wall of over compressed mush. What’s going on?


It's called the Loudness War - it started 10 to 15 years ago, and the purpose was apparently to make music sound as loud as commercials on the radio.

Fortunately this trend is turning, but there's still a lot of good music being squeezed to death and becoming victims to this Loudness War.
